Suggestions
Xiaoyao Qian
Software Engineer at Twitter, Apache Heron Committer
Xiaoyao Qian is a highly accomplished software engineer with extensive experience in the tech industry, particularly in data processing, machine learning infrastructure, and distributed systems. Here's an overview of his career and achievements:
Professional Experience
Current Role: Xiaoyao Qian currently works as a Senior Software Engineer II at Cruise, a position he has held since May 2023.1 Cruise is known for its work in autonomous vehicle technology.
Previous Roles at Twitter: Xiaoyao had a significant tenure at Twitter, progressing through several roles:
-
Senior Software Engineer (October 2021 - April 2023)
- Led ML infrastructure optimization projects
- Achieved over $18 million/year in infrastructure cost savings
- Designed real-time ads ML training data pipeline1
-
Software Engineer II (June 2019 - October 2021)
- Developed scalable, streaming-first data processing stacks
- Led migration of ~180 data processing pipelines1
-
Software Engineer I (December 2018 - June 2019)
- Contributed to Apache Heron project
- Improved resource allocation, resulting in 10% lower CPU core and 20% lower RAM usage1
-
Software Engineering Intern (June 2017 - August 2017)
- Created a PrestoDB connector for Twitter's customized Kafka 0.71
Other Notable Experience
- Apache Heron Committer at The Apache Software Foundation (September 2019 - Present)1
- Co-Founder and Tech Lead at NAD Grid Corp (October 2017 - December 2018)1
- Tech Yahoo, Software Development Engineer at Yahoo (July 2014 - August 2016)1
Education
Xiaoyao Qian holds a Master's degree in Computer Science from the University of Illinois at Urbana-Champaign.12 During his time there, he also worked as an Undergraduate Research Assistant at the Coordinated Science Laboratory.1
Skills and Expertise
Xiaoyao's expertise spans various areas of software engineering, including:
- Machine Learning Infrastructure
- Data Processing and Analytics
- Distributed Systems
- Cloud Computing (Google Cloud, Dataflow)
- Open Source Contributions (Apache Heron)
- Blockchain Technology
Languages
Xiaoyao is proficient in both Chinese (native or bilingual proficiency) and English.1
Xiaoyao Qian's career trajectory demonstrates a strong focus on building scalable, efficient systems for data processing and machine learning, particularly in the context of social media and advertising technology. His contributions have led to significant improvements in system performance and cost savings at major tech companies.